For Honor New Trailer Debuts During TGS 2015

Ubisoft's melee combat title returns.

Ubisoft introduced some new footage for Ubisoft Montreal’s For Honor, a medieval hack and slash title which emphasizes realistic combat and mixes factions like the Samurai, Vikings and knights together. Check it out below.

For Honor debuted at this year’s Electronic Entertainment Expo and focuses on competitive multiplayer between two teams of up to eight players with AI bots. Points are earned as kills are racked up and when a certain point limit is reached, players must face each other in dramatic duels.

These focus on positioning and trying to one-up your opponent – killing all opposing players ultimately ends the match. It sounds simple but when you mix in the brutally realistic combat, it’s well worth a look.
